2. Technical Architecture & Practical Implementation

Implementing The Future of Web Automation in 2026: AI, 5G Proxies, and Beyond requires addressing deep transport and application layer security constraints. Modern target systems inspect incoming socket connections for TCP window sizes, HTTP/2 settings frames, and TLS Extension signatures (JA3/JA4).

4.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What is the core technical challenge in The Future of Web Automation in 2026: AI, 5G Proxies, and Beyond?

The primary challenge in The Future of Web Automation in 2026: AI, 5G Proxies, and Beyond is overcoming anti-bot rate limits, TLS/JA4 fingerprint inspection, and maintaining stable proxy session IP addresses.

Which proxy type yields the highest success rate?

Residential and 5G Mobile proxy pools yield the highest success rates (98.5%+) due to their assignment by real consumer Internet Service Providers (ISPs).

How should request timeouts and retries be configured?

Configure request timeouts to 10–15 seconds and implement exponential backoff algorithms with per-request IP rotation upon encountering 403 or 429 status codes.
